Antoni Gaudí

Over the course of his career, Antoni Gaudí translated the gothic revival style into a sensuous, surreal, and highly idiosyncratic design language that established him as the leader within the Spanish art nouveau movement. Using location footage, drawings, and archival photos and film, this program places Gaudí within the context of his profession and his times. His Colonia Güell, Park Güell, Casa Batlló, Casa Milá, and Sagrada Familia are featured. (Spanish with English subtitles, 49 minutes)
